elasticsearch2.2的单机安装

  •   性能描述

 elasticsearch2.2的性能还是非常好的,我这里使用了5个虚拟机性能很一般的虚拟机如图:


没有副本,20个分片,数据量为250g,文档数为5.7亿条,这样的查询还能0.1秒查到:


  • 安装步骤

言归正传说说安装吧

从官网下载elasticsearch-2.2.0.tar.gz

上传linux服务器

修改配置文件elasticsearch-2.2.0/config/elasticsearch.yml

</pre><pre name="code" class="html">#使节点名使用主机名
node.name: ${HOSTNAME}
#使用网口eth0网卡
network.host: _eth0_
#集群机器列表2.2不配置这个不能自动发现其他节点
discovery.zen.ping.unicast.hosts: ["host213", "host217", "host221", "host231","host236"]
#修改集群名称
cluster.name: ehl_elasticsearch
#修改数据保存路径
path.data: /data/elasticsearch/indexdata
path.work: /data/elasticsearch/work
path.logs: /data/elasticsearch/logs
#允许es锁定内存防止gc时间太长
bootstrap.mlockall: true
ES_MIN_MEM: 4g
ES_MAX_MEM: 4g
#禁用动态创建索引(性能不高,防止脏数据搞乱索引)
index.mapper.dynamic: false

修改linux的环境变量/etc/profile

#设置系统环境变量确定es可以锁内存
ulimit -l unlimited 

  • 启动描述
由于es2.2为了安全考虑默认不允许使用root启动,但是我们这个先不管安全问题,怎么启动呢

安装head
plugin install mobz/elasticsearch-head


命令如下:
./elasticsearch -d -D es.insecure.allow.root=true

独立安装的就完成了。性能不错。




  • 1
    点赞
  • 1
    收藏
    觉得还不错? 一键收藏
  • 2
    评论

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论 2
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值